The Model 318 is the same bike , with this square 90° box, the 318 Fairing is definitely more aerodynamic than the right angle box.
Coroplast™ material allows a more rapid turnover on new design updates. Fiberglass projects always seem to get bogged down while trrying to get enough pre-orders to justify building a mold.
The 3xx models are based on the Type 3 Prototype Aerodynamic Fairing, which I built over 30 years ago.
